True / False 2. A vaccination is available against the Hepatitis B virus, but there is currently no vaccine or cure for Hepatitis C or HIV. PREVENTING EXPOSURES. Bloodborne pathogens are microorganisms that can cause diseases, some fatal, such as Hepatitis B and C as well as HIV. These microorganisms can be carried in infected blood and bodily fluids. T; 3.
